Rates & Terms
FHA loans in OR typically offer rates 0.25% to 0.50% higher than conventional loans but require only 3.5% down.
Borrowers in Wilsonville with credit scores above 760 and 20% down payments qualify for the best conventional mortgage rates.
Requirements in Wilsonville
VA loans require a valid Certificate of Eligibility and meet minimum service requirements; no down payment is required in Wilsonville.
FHA loans in OR accept credit scores as low as 580 with 3.5% down, or 500-579 with 10% down.

Borrowing Tips for Wilsonville
- Improve your credit score by 20+ points before applying; even small improvements can lower your rate significantly.
- Consider a 15-year mortgage if you can afford the higher payment; you will save massive interest over the loan life.
- Get pre-approved, not just pre-qualified; a pre-approval letter strengthens your offer in competitive Wilsonville markets.
